JSON API pro pirátské fórum

Technický odbor působí v oblasti správy, údržby a vývoje technických systémů strany a jejích technických zařízení a poskytuje servis ostatním orgánům strany.

Moderátor: Odbor - technicky

Pravidla fóra
  • Sem vkládejte připomínky k činnosti technického odboru. Ke každému podnětu založte nové téma.
  • Na dotazy a podněty odpovídají dobrovolníci, buďte prosím ohleduplní. Svá podání pište slušně a požadavky formulujte dostatečně určitě.
  • Místo odkazů do jiných fór citujte celé texty, protože lidé mají zobrazování některých fór vypnuté.
  • V podatelně se nediskutuje a jakmile bylo podání vyřešeno, téma se zamyká.
Další informace můžete nalézt na následujících místech:
Zamčeno
Karel Bilek
Uživatel fóra – není člen Pirátů
Příspěvky: 393
Registrován: 06 dub 2012, 18:52
Profese: student
Dal poděkování: 420 poděkování
Dostal poděkování: 500 poděkování

JSON API pro pirátské fórum

Příspěvek od Karel Bilek »

Zdravím,

mám návrh - otevřené JSON API pro naše fórum. Docela mě štve, že nic takového není a je nutné číst fórum jenom přes tuhle stránku, přičemž by bylo dobré dát přístup i separátním programům a dalším klientům. Konkrétně - já osobně bych třeba rád napsal něco, co bude dělat na našem fóru data mining a bude automaticky hledat klíčová slova (aby se v tom líp orientovalo, žejo) OFFTOPIC(s hledáním klíčových slov v českém textu jsem si trochu hrál, implementovat TF-IDF je jednodušší, než by člověk čekal)

Nevýhoda - bylo by to potřeba celé napsat - existuje tenhle phpBB modul - https://github.com/pcrumm/phpbb.json , ale nevím, jak je funkční. Plus by bylo hezké, kdyby v tom JSON API byly i všechny různé další funkce, co na fóru jsou (napadají mě teď jenom palce nahoru, možná tu je i něco dalšího).

Nabízím se jako člověk, co by to klidně dopsal a otestoval :), čas na psaní čehokoliv mám ale až v říjnu.
Tito uživatelé poděkovali autorovi Karel Bilek za příspěvky (celkem 3):
Mikulas.Ferjencik, Stanislav.Stipl, Petr.Kopac
Uživatelský avatar
Lukas.Novy
Příspěvky: 21224
Registrován: 02 črc 2009, 22:45
Profese: specialista pocitacove bezpecnosti
Bydliště: Praha, V Klaudu 42
Dal poděkování: 2361 poděkování
Dostal poděkování: 11863 poděkování
Kontaktovat uživatele:

Re: JSON API pro pirátské fórum

Příspěvek od Lukas.Novy »

Mel by fakcit pristup pres rss: gymrss.php?channels

Problem s data mining spociva v tom, ze urcite casti jsou viditelne jenom urcitym rolim, takze majnit by se dalo, ale musi to bezet uvnitr fora a vystupi musi byt taky soucasti fora, aby se dalo overovat prava pri vystupu (kdykoliv predtim je to spatne).

Z dalsich projektu, ktere se snazi o podobnou vec je treba OFAPI, ale i to je zrejme abandoned.

Obecne se modifikacim fora nebranim, ale nenasadim nic, co neni v produkcnim stavu podle phpbb.com... uz kvuli bezpecnosti.
Tito uživatelé poděkovali autorovi Lukas.Novy za příspěvek:
Karel Bilek
pani nováková povídala, že u vás na balkóně
sou furt ňáký kluci, kouřej a smějou se.
| ‒ | – | — | ― | … | „ | “ | ‚ | ‘ | » | « | ½ | ¼ | ¾ | × | ‰ | ® | © | ™ | Fotku Stierlitze jako avatara mi zakazali, toz sem nahodil catvatara.
Karel Bilek
Uživatel fóra – není člen Pirátů
Příspěvky: 393
Registrován: 06 dub 2012, 18:52
Profese: student
Dal poděkování: 420 poděkování
Dostal poděkování: 500 poděkování

Re: JSON API pro pirátské fórum

Příspěvek od Karel Bilek »

Lukas Novy píše:Mel by fakcit pristup pres rss: gymrss.php?channels
OK, zkusim, jak to vypadá a k čemu se přes ty RSSka dá dostat. Pokud jenom ke psaní a ne ke čtení, tak je to tak půlka toho, co by se mi líbilo :)
Lukas Novy píše:Problem s data mining spociva v tom, ze urcite casti jsou viditelne jenom urcitym rolim, takze majnit by se dalo, ale musi to bezet uvnitr fora a vystupi musi byt taky soucasti fora, aby se dalo overovat prava pri vystupu (kdykoliv predtim je to spatne).
Hm, pravda, my vlastně "tajíme" nepřístupné části. Tj. muselo by se to opravdu kontrolovat při výstupu. Na druhou stranu, k data miningu toho zas až tolik potřeba není.

Moje původní motivace byla - asi 3 měsíce jsem nebyl na fóru a teď chci zjistit, co je důležité, a mám tu tuny kydů. Tak přemýšlím, že bych si napsal něco, co mi vypíše klíčová slova a najde důležité příspěvky :)
Lukas Novy píše:Z dalsich projektu, ktere se snazi o podobnou vec je treba OFAPI, ale i to je zrejme abandoned.

Obecne se modifikacim fora nebranim, ale nenasadim nic, co neni v produkcnim stavu podle phpbb.com... uz kvuli bezpecnosti.
OK, v tom případě teda JSON API nebude, protože ten modul, co jsem našel, nevypadá absolutně jako v produkčním stavu. (Já osobně rád experimentuju, ale chápu, že tohle fórum je asi moc velké pro experimenty.)
Karel Bilek
Uživatel fóra – není člen Pirátů
Příspěvky: 393
Registrován: 06 dub 2012, 18:52
Profese: student
Dal poděkování: 420 poděkování
Dostal poděkování: 500 poděkování

Re: JSON API pro pirátské fórum

Příspěvek od Karel Bilek »

No, těm RSSkám vůbec nerozumim.

Které RSSko mě dostane k samotným příspěvkům? Jediné, co z nich vytáhnu, jsou odkazy zpátky do fóra, a to už se musí nějak parsovat ručně. To si můžu to fórum wgetovat ručně...
Zamčeno

Zpět na „Podatelna technického odboru“